Flip Open (FO mode)

When the flip is opened, the large touch-screen is revealed. In ‘flip open’ mode, the stylus may be used to navigate and enter data. The Jog Dial provides further navigation and selection capability. The User Interface is Symbian’s established UIQ design, adapted for the narrower 208 pixel screen.

Text may be entered using natural handwriting over the whole screen. Lower case letters are

entered below the symbol, uppercase in line with it and numbers above it.

An on-screen keyboard is also available at all times by tapping on the keyboard icon in the status bar. Symbol and special character keyboards may be selected when required. Cut, Copy and Paste functions are available here.

In FO mode, the P802 offers Stroke, Pinyin and Bopomofo input methods plus Chinese character recognition. Numeric and English characters can also be entered using the character recognition.
